How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fairmont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fairmont Park Studio Apartments | $2,254 | $1,650 | $3,750 |
| Fairmont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,427 | $1,595 | $3,715 |
| Fairmont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,898 | $1,843 | $6,331 |
| Fairmont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,504 | $2,395 | $10,000+ |
| Fairmont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,585 | $1,250 | $3,476 |
